Indirect Iran-US Talks to Take Place in Switzerland with Omani Mediation

Indirect negotiations between the Islamic Republic of Iran and the United States of America are scheduled to take place tomorrow at the Omani embassy in Switzerland. These talks will be mediated by Oman, and the two sides will not meet face-to-face directly.
According to released information, this meeting is held amid ongoing diplomatic developments surrounding issues of mutual interest to both countries. No official details regarding the agenda of these negotiations have been announced so far.
Additionally, the Iranian Foreign Minister is set to deliver a speech on Tuesday at the Disarmament Conference, one of the major international gatherings on arms control and security matters.
Furthermore, in response to repeated requests from the Director General of the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A), a meeting between the Iranian Foreign Minister and Rafael Grossi is also being considered. If this meeting occurs, its focus will likely be on topics related to technical and supervisory cooperation between Iran and the IAEA.
